Figure 2
Shell of Megalobulimus dryades sp. nov.: (A-D) holotype (MZSP 120000, Iporanga, SP), (A) apertural view, (B) lateral view, (C) abapertural view, (D) apical view; C and D showing the shell measurements: L = length, W = width, H = height; (E-F) paratype (MZSP 29317, Iguape, SP), (E) apertural view, (F) abapertural view; (G-H) paratype (MZSP 28773, Iguape, SP), (G) apertural view, (H) abapertural view; (I) paratype (MZSP 15594), apical view of protoconch in SEM.

Figure 9
Megalobulimus dryadessp. nov. and M. gummatus in S-SE Brazil: Geographical distributions based on MZSP specimens. Megalobulimus dryades sp. nov. (circles; star indicating type locality, Iporanga) in south São Paulo state; M. gummatus (triangle) on the central coast of Rio de Janeiro state (type locality).
